Fan-out backpressure for the Quillet notifier: when the queue depth crosses the soft limit, the dispatcher sheds low-priority pushes and batches the rest at 500ms intervals. Reviewer should confirm the shed counter is exported and that retries respect the jitter window. Once merged, the release artifact gets re-signed by the pipeline, which expects the deploy key shown below.

deploy key for bawep-yawif: bky6_GQhaSt

## Deploying the Gatewick Proctor Queue

Deploys are pretty painless: push to main, wait for the pipeline, then watch the queue drain dashboard for five minutes. If candidates pile up mid-exam, roll back first and ask questions later — the queue replays safely. Everything the workers care about lives in one config block, shown here for reference.

settings of bafof-yagef:
JOROX_PIN=8740
JOROX_TENANT=pelox
JOROX_METRICS_HOST=metrics.jorox.qorvelworks.internal
JOROX_SEAL=seal_c78f63c1
JOROX_STANDBY_TEAM=norax

### Key Ceremony Checklist — Item 7: Orders Table Soft-Delete Keys

Confirm that the Ordervane service's soft-delete encryption keys are rotated before sealing. Soft-deleted rows in the orders table remain encrypted under the prior key for 90 days; verify the retention job in Graymarrow has completed its sweep. Witness signatures must be collected before proceeding. Once both custodians confirm, unseal the ceremony envelope for the soft-delete keystore using the recovery passphrase recorded below.

vault phrase of bagaf-kajeg = jorath-feniel-briir-siliel-ralix

**Action item (P1, owner: on-call):** So, the Fernwick profile store fell over again because everything lives on one poor shard. We need to split it by user-ID hash into at least eight shards before the next traffic bump — the dual-write migration plan is already drafted, it just needs someone to kick off phase one and babysit the backfill. Budget a couple of days and keep an eye on replication lag. The full migration checklist is on the internal page below.

runbook for badug-kadup: https://confluence.zemvarlabs.internal/projects/browse/display/projects/bd1b